2005 Ford Mondeo vs. 2005 Hyundai Sonata
To start off, both 2005 Ford Mondeo and 2005 Hyundai Sonata were released in the same year (2005).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 2,262 cc (4 cylinders), 2005 Ford Mondeo is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Ford Mondeo (149 HP @ 3500 RPM) has 18 more horse power than 2005 Hyundai Sonata. (131 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Ford Mondeo should accelerate faster than 2005 Hyundai Sonata.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Ford Mondeo (374 Nm @ 1800 RPM) has 194 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Hyundai Sonata. (180 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 2005 Ford Mondeo will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Hyundai Sonata.
